Job Description & How to Apply Below
* Teach all courses, as assigned, for the full duration of scheduled instruction
* Be fully prepared with a syllabus and instructional plans for each class session in accord with the stated objectives of the course
* Enforce academic policy and procedures at all times, and comply with institutional rules and regulations
* Maintain complete course and student records, reports, and forms
* Stay current with developments in the field of instruction
* Assume other necessary responsibilities and perform additional tasks as assigned by the chair, department dean, chief instructional officer, or president, in meeting the needs of the department, division, and college
* Assume responsibility for laboratory/classroom preparation, including maintenance and cleanup, and recommend, as necessary, appropriate laboratory supplies and equipment
* Must complete mandatory training.
A bachelor's degree in Japanese or related field. Native speakers of Japanese will be considered with a degree in another field.
Preferred Qualifications
A master's degree in Japanese; or a master's degree in a related field with at least 18 graduate semester hours in Japanese
Work Experience
Successful experience teaching Japanese at a university or community college is preferred.
* Thorough understanding of and commitment to the mission and philosophy of the North Carolina Community College System
* Demonstrated ability to use modern instructional technology (Microsoft Office, learning management systems, e-mail, Internet, student information databases, library research databases) and experience with Internet-based instruction
* Competence in oral and written communication skills necessary for effective teaching
* Ability to be organized, accurate, and punctual with paperwork and assigned tasks
* Sensitivity to the needs and expectations of students, colleagues, and community groups
* Ability to establish and maintain effective, civil, and respectful communication and interpersonal relations throughout the college and the community
* Personal integrity, honesty, and the ability to maintain confidentiality
